The pagan queen refers to a female ruler who practices or is associated with pagan religions or beliefs. Throughout history, there have been several pagan queens who have left a significant impact on their societies. These queens often held religious and political authority, leading their people in both spiritual and worldly matters. One notable pagan queen is Boudicca, also known as Boadicea, who ruled over the Iceni tribe in ancient Britain. Boudicca led a rebellion against the Roman occupation in 60 or 61 AD, after her husband's death and the Romans attempted to seize her lands. She is remembered for her fierce leadership and bravery in battle, becoming a symbol of resistance against the Roman invaders.

In Norse mythology, Freyja is a prominent goddess associated with love, beauty, fertility, war, and death. She is often depicted as a powerful and independent queen, ruling over the heavenly realm of Fólkvangr. Freyja is renowned for her bravery in battle and her ability to choose half of the slain warriors to reside in her realm. The pagan queen Morgan le Fay from Arthurian legends is another notable figure. As a powerful sorceress, Morgan is often portrayed as a complex character with ambiguous motives. She is associated with magic, nature, and the old pagan ways. Despite her antagonistic role in some stories, Morgan le Fay is also depicted as a wise and influential queen, possessing great knowledge and mystical abilities.
